FAQs

What are Mastercard QMR and Visa GOC reports?

Card scheme reports, such as Mastercard QMR and Visa GOC reports, are comprehensive data submissions required by card networks from institutions involved in payment processing. They are essential for compliance, financial reconciliation and performance analysis in payments.

What do card scheme reports include?

Mastercard QMR and Visa GOC data reports include detailed information on transaction volumes, types and values processed over a specific period, usually each quarter. They also encompass data on cardholder activity, interchange fees, currency conversions and other transaction metrics.

Why are card scheme reports important?

Card scheme reports are crucial because they provide insights into transaction processing and fraud prevention, helping to mitigate risks associated with data security and contribute to the network integrity of the wider payments ecosystem.

What is a Mastercard T140 file?

A T140 file is a specific data format used in Mastercard QMR reports. It defines the format and structure of transaction data exchanged between financial institutions, payment processors and card networks for reporting purposes. It covers metrics like transaction amounts, merchant details and cardholder information.

What are the penalties for failed data submissions?

Penalties for failed Mastercard QMR and Visa GOC data submissions vary depending on the severity and frequency of errors. Businesses may face financial penalties, fines, sanctions or even suspension from card networks in severe cases.

Which companies need to submit Mastercard QMR or Visa GOC reports?

Card scheme reporting requirements apply to entities that process, accept, and facilitate card payment transactions. This includes financial institutions like banks and credit unions, payment processors, merchants, acquiring banks or merchant account providers, payment gateways and independent sales organisations (ISOs).

How do card scheme reports ensure timely transaction settlement?

Card scheme reports play a crucial role in the timely settlement of transactions in the payments ecosystem. Reports enable Mastercard and Visa to reconcile transactions efficiently and prevent settlement delays by providing comprehensive data on transactions, discrepancies and errors.

Are there specific formatting requirements for reports?

Yes, both Mastercard and Visa have specific formatting requirements when businesses submit their data. These typically include report structure, data fields and formatting standards like file type, encoding and layout. Each card network has predefined templates or formats for specific fields.
